Industry
TDS Adjuster, Reverse Osmosis Plant Parts, Water Treatment & Purification Plant, Product Rental & Leasing, Effluent Treatment Plants Installation, Plant Installation Services, Plant Design & Installation Services, Industrial Plants & Machinery, Wastewater Treatment Services, Waste Management & Control Services
HQ Location
D-180, Abul Fazal Enclave-I, Jamia Nagar, South Delhi, Current Okhla Vihar Metro Station, Delhi-110025, India